Description
This unit involves the skills and knowledge required to monitor and operate fluoride addition processes.It includes preparing for fluoridation processes, applying fluoride dosing and reporting on water quality control.This unit applies to those working as water operators responsible for fluoridation processes in water treatment. Those undertaking this unit would work under appropriate supervision, while performing routine tasks, in a range of familiar contexts.No licensing, legislative or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of publication.

Elements and Performance Criteria
1 Prepare for work
- 1.1 Determine work requirements from job specifications and plans
- 1.2 Select and check equipment required to meet safety requirements of task and worksite
- 1.3 Select, fit and use required safety equipment, including personal protective equipment (PPE)
- 1.4 Handle and store fluoridation chemicals according to workplace procedures
2 Monitor processes
- 2.1 Monitor fluoridation processes according to workplace procedures
- 2.2 Collect samples and conduct process tests according to workplace procedures
- 2.3 Perform calculations and make process adjustments to maintain effectiveness of fluoride according to workplace procedures
- 2.4 Monitor the parameter set points for critical control points and operational control points
3 Apply fluoride dosing
- 3.1 Prepare and apply fluoridation chemicals according to workplace procedures
- 3.2 Control fluoride dosing to maintain required fluoride concentration
- 3.3 Maintain information relating to fluoride supply and usage according to workplace procedures
4 Complete documentation
- 4.1 Collect, record and complete process data according to workplace procedures and process requirements
- 4.2 Identify data outside of normal operational parameters to relevant personnel for further action
